Your text

The information that you wish to appear on your page should be supplied either as a Microsoft Word document, or as plain text in the body of an email.

Please keep the text to a reasonable length, a maximum of approximately 300 words. If you wish, you can include a list of your qualifications or achievements. These lists should be brief (no more than ten items) and only contain information that is relevant and likely to be of interest to visitors to your page.

Images

A maximum of six images of your work can now be displayed on your page. These will initially display as square cropped thumbnails, but clicking on any one will open the full image at a fairly large size, up to 700px on the longest side. For this reason, when sending your images they should be at least that size. If in doubt just make sure thay are sent at the full size that they come from the camera and Steve will size them for you. Images should be sent as jpg's, preferably as email attachments, or by post on a CD or memory-stick. See above for Steve's contact details. If emailing images, the total file size of attachments to any one email should not exceed 20Mb, otherwise they may be rejected.

With each image supplied, you should provide the name of the work, medium and, if you wish, width and height. These details will be displayed underneath each image on your page.
